**13 Stylishly Cozy Bedrooms in Chic Neutral Tones**

Neutral tones have become a staple in modern interior design, and for good reason. These hues bring a sense of calm, warmth, and sophistication to any space, making them ideal for creating a cozy yet stylish bedroom. If you're looking to transform your bedroom into a serene retreat, these 13 examples of chic neutral-tone bedrooms are sure to inspire.

### 1. **Minimalist Elegance**
A soft palette of cream, beige, and light gray creates a minimalist aesthetic while keeping the space inviting. Simple furnishings with clean lines allow the neutral tones to shine without overwhelming the senses.

### 2. **Textural Warmth**
Incorporating different textures like plush rugs, knit throws, and linen bedding elevates a neutral room. Subtle contrast between materials like wood, fabric, and stone helps create depth and coziness.

### 3. **Earthy Tones with Modern Flair**
Using neutral tones inspired by nature—such as warm taupes, sandy beiges, and muted greens—brings an organic, earthy feel. Adding sleek, modern furniture prevents the room from feeling too rustic, balancing both worlds.

### 4. **Layered Neutrals**
Layering various shades of the same color family, like ivory, cream, and soft brown, creates a harmonious and balanced look. Pile on throw blankets, pillows, and a variety of textiles to add dimension and coziness.

### 5. **Boho Meets Neutral**
Mixing bohemian elements like macramé wall hangings and woven baskets with a neutral color scheme creates a cozy, eclectic vibe. The muted tones keep the space grounded and peaceful, while the boho accents add personality.

### 6. **Neutral with a Pop of Gold**
To add a touch of luxury, incorporate gold accents like light fixtures, picture frames, or mirror details. The metallic elements catch the light and stand out beautifully against the soft neutral backdrop.

### 7. **Scandinavian Simplicity**
Scandinavian-inspired bedrooms often embrace neutral color schemes with a focus on simplicity and functionality. Light wood furniture paired with crisp white walls and soft gray linens creates a serene, uncluttered atmosphere.

### 8. **Monochrome Chic**
A monochrome bedroom in shades of gray can be anything but boring when balanced with cozy fabrics and stylish accessories. Adding touches of greenery or a black-and-white photograph creates visual interest in the space.

### 9. **Rustic Charm**
Exposed wooden beams, neutral bedding, and soft lighting combine to create a rustic yet elegant bedroom. The natural textures and soft colors evoke a sense of coziness, perfect for those who love a modern farmhouse style.

### 10. **Urban Loft**
Industrial meets cozy in this chic urban bedroom. Exposed brick walls, sleek neutral bedding, and contemporary furniture come together to create a stylish city retreat without sacrificing comfort.

### 11. **Vintage Accents**
Incorporate vintage furniture or retro decor in neutral hues to create a timeless, chic space. A neutral palette allows the vintage pieces to shine without clashing with other elements in the room.

### 12. **Serene Retreat**
If relaxation is your priority, choose calming neutral tones like soft grays, whites, and sandy beiges. Use sheer curtains to let in natural light and opt for minimal decor to keep the space serene and peaceful.

### 13. **Cozy Modern Farmhouse**
This cozy bedroom features a modern farmhouse look with white shiplap walls, warm wood accents, and layers of neutral-toned bedding. The result is a space that feels both inviting and chic, blending rustic charm with modern sensibility.
